Orange Polska operates a colocation data center facility in Kraków, Poland, strategically positioned at ul. Rakowicka 51 in one of Poland's most important technology and business hubs. As part of Orange Polska Spolka Akcyjna, one of Poland's leading telecommunications providers, this facility leverages the company's extensive network infrastructure and operational expertise to deliver enterprise-grade colocation services.

Facility Overview

This Kraków data center serves as a critical infrastructure node for organizations requiring reliable hosting solutions in southern Poland. The facility benefits from Orange Polska's position as a major telecommunications operator, providing tenants with direct access to the carrier's robust network backbone and connectivity resources. The location on Rakowicka street places the facility within Kraków's established business district, ensuring reliable utility infrastructure and accessibility for both technical staff and client personnel.

Kraków Colocation Market

Kraków has emerged as a significant data center market within Central and Eastern Europe, driven by the city's role as a major business and technology hub in Poland. The city's strategic location provides excellent connectivity to both Western European markets and emerging economies in Eastern Europe, making it an attractive location for organizations seeking to establish regional data center presence.

Geographic and Infrastructure Advantages

The city benefits from robust telecommunications infrastructure, reliable power grid connectivity, and a relatively low risk profile for natural disasters. Kraków's position as Poland's second-largest city ensures strong utility infrastructure and multiple connectivity pathways, while its location away from major fault lines and coastal areas provides inherent disaster resilience. The city's well-developed transportation infrastructure facilitates both initial deployments and ongoing operational support for data center facilities.

Business Environment

Kraków has developed into a major center for business process outsourcing, financial services, and technology companies, creating strong demand for local data center services. The presence of numerous multinational corporations, combined with a growing startup ecosystem, drives consistent demand for both retail and wholesale colocation services. The city's EU membership provides regulatory stability and ensures compliance with European data protection standards, making it attractive for organizations requiring EU data residency.
